In today’s world of digital design, the ISE Design Suite is more than just software—it’s the backbone of how many programmable logic devices are created. From simple logic circuits to complex system-on-chips, the ISE Design Suite powers the tools that engineers use to bring their designs to life. This article delves into what the ISE Design Suite is, its key features, and why it matters.
What is ISE Design Suite?
The ISE (Integrated Synthesis Environment) Design Suite is a software package produced by Xilinx for FPGA (Field-Programmable Gate Array) design. Think of it as a complete workbench: just as a carpenter uses various tools to build furniture, an FPGA designer uses the ISE Design Suite to create, simulate, and implement digital circuits. Whether it’s designing a communication system or a control circuit, the ISE Design Suite is at the core of many digital designs.
Key Features
The ISE Design Suite comes with a range of capabilities, each tailored to specific design stages. Here are some prominent features:
- Synthesis: This feature translates high-level descriptions, such as VHDL or Verilog code, into a gate-level representation that can be implemented on an FPGA.
- Simulation: This allows designers to test their circuits before implementing them on hardware. This includes both functional and timing simulations.
- Implementation: This process maps the design onto the FPGA, including placement and routing of logic elements and interconnects.
- Device Programming: This involves generating the bitstream file that configures the FPGA with the implemented design.
Why ISE Design Suite Matters
The ISE Design Suite is the driving force behind the rapid prototyping and development of digital systems. For instance, aerospace engineers use the ISE Design Suite to design custom processors, while telecommunications companies use it to implement complex signal processing algorithms. In industries like automotive, the ISE Design Suite assists in developing advanced driver-assistance systems.
Optimizing designs within the ISE Design Suite can significantly reduce resource utilization and improve performance. A well-optimized design reduces power consumption and increases processing speed, making systems more efficient.
Applications of ISE Design Suite in Everyday Design
The ISE Design Suite is ubiquitous, shaping how many digital products are developed:
- Telecommunications: Implementing complex modulation schemes in communication systems.
- Aerospace: Designing high-performance, fault-tolerant computing systems for satellites.
- Automotive: Developing advanced driver-assistance systems (ADAS) with real-time image processing.
- Industrial Automation: Implementing custom control systems for manufacturing processes.
Must-Know Facts About ISE Design Suite
Creating efficient designs in the ISE Design Suite requires understanding its specific capabilities. Here are some key facts:
- HDL Support: The ISE Design Suite supports industry-standard hardware description languages like VHDL and Verilog.
- IP Cores: The tool suite includes a library of pre-designed intellectual property (IP) cores that can be integrated into designs.
- Constraints Editor: Using constraints, designers can specify timing requirements, pin assignments, and other design parameters to optimize the implementation.
- Power Analysis: Designers can analyze power consumption to optimize for low-power applications.
The Evolution of ISE Design Suite
As technology advances, so does the ISE Design Suite. While Xilinx has transitioned to the Vivado Design Suite for newer FPGA families, the ISE Design Suite remains important for supporting older devices. Continuous improvements in algorithms and tool capabilities have enabled designers to create more complex and efficient designs.
Conclusion
The ISE Design Suite is a critical tool for digital designers, enabling the creation of everything from communication systems to complex embedded processors. Understanding how the ISE Design Suite works and its applications can help you appreciate the technology shaping our world. Whether you’re a seasoned engineer or a student, staying informed about the ISE Design Suite is key to excelling in digital design.